- The distance between Lodgepole, Ne, Usa and Ioannina, Greece is approximately 9,396 km or 5,839 mi.
- To reach Lodgepole, Ne in this distance one would set out from Ioannina bearing 321°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Lodgepole, Ne bearing 220° or SW .
- Lodgepole, Ne has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Ioannina has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Lodgepole, Ne is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Ioannina is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 4.1 °C (7.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.9 °C (12.4°F) more in Lodgepole, Ne.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 611.4 mm (24.1 in) less which is equivalent to 611.4 l/m² (15.01 US gal/ft²) or 6,114,000 l/ha (653,627 US gal/ac) less. About 3/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1.3° lower in Lodgepole, Ne than in Ioannina.
